  • Patent number: 12348283
    Abstract: Techniques for improved wireless reliability are provided. It is determined that a client device is at least one of an augmented reality (AR) or a virtual reality (VR) device. A default set of retry parameters and a second set of retry parameters are determined, where the second set of retry parameters result in increased wireless reliability, as compared to the default set of retry parameters. Data is transmitted to the client device using the second set of retry parameters.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 29, 2024
    Date of Patent: July 1, 2025
    Assignee: Cisco Technology, Inc.
    Inventors: Wai-Tian Tan, Robert E. Liston, Herbert M. Wildfeuer
